frequent flier kindness



Right when you think you have lost your faith in humanity, something happens to reignite that faith. This is a true story, it happened yesterday on a domestic flight.

A friend of mines husband, we will call him "J" works for a paper company. Friday, he was returning home from a three day business trip. As it is the weekend before Christmas his flight was crowded with holiday travelers, one being a soldier who was going home for Christmas who was seated next to him.  The two struck up a conversation, the soldier was entertaining J with some of his experiences being overseas. Just after take off when the "stay in your seats" light when off, the stewardess approached them and told the soldier that a man in First Class wants to trade seats with him. The soldier, politely said its okay, that he was fine sitting in coach.
The stewardess said the man in first class was being a bit persistent, and insisted the soldier have his seat.
The soldier then agreed, got up, shook "Js" hand and moved up to first class. J sat there for a bit with a smile on his face, that is when the first class passenger came back to the seat in coach. J looked at him for a bit, and asked "Why"
The passenger was an elderly man, obviously wealthy, and explained that his son had died in Afghanistan, and he has made it his mission to give back: when he could and as much as he could for our military- including something as trivial as a airline seat "The sacrifices they make, giving up a seat to say Thanks, is the least I can do"........

When I first heard this, I thought about the true meaning of Christmas: "Giving, instead of Receiving" ....   With things the way they are in this country, with this "Me, Myself and I" generation. Its good to hear that there are still people out there who do nice things for others....
